THE BROADWAY CHALLENGE, a new and unique app for theatre trivia, was launched through the Apple App Store this weekend. Created by Dramatic Forces, the App functions on iPhone, iPad and iPod Touch devices. THE BROADWAY CHALLENGE is a must have app for every theatre fan. It's a multi-layered, multi game, all theatre trivia immersion with gorgeous graphics and sound effects. Play against yourself, your friends, the rest of the world. With 10 challenge games, eight unique question categories, and over 4000 original questions, you can play non-stop for an entire Broadway season and still not hit every question. The Broadway Challenge App will be updated with special new trivia packages throughout the year.

THE BROADWAY CHALLENGE app is $2.99 and a portion of the proceeds will benefit Broadway Cares / Equity Fights AIDS.

"This is a first of its kind Broadway app," says Dori Berinstein, creator of THE BROADWAY CHALLENGE. "It's our hope that our app will bring theatre fans of all ages together and introduce Broadway to new audiences.

The app was official launced Sunday, September 26, 2010 at the 24th Annual Broadway Flea Market & Grand Auction, in Shubert Alley where Kristen Chenoweth (Promises Promises, "Glee"), John Tartaglia (Avenue Q, ImaginOcean, Disney's TV series Johnny and the Sprites)"), Jackie Hoffman (The Addams Family, Xanadu, Hairspray), Andrea McArdle (Annie, Les MIserables), Ann Harada (Avenue Q, Les Miserables), Seth Rudetsky (They're Paying Our Song, The Ritz), Neil McCaffrey and Ben Cook (Billy Elliot) and other theatre stars played 'Take The Challenge' with Flea Market visitors. iPods were awarded to top scorers of the day and an iPad package was auctioned off at the BC/EFA Grand Auction.

THE BROADWAY CHALLENGE has been produced by Dramatic Forces, an award-winning theatrical entertainment company, founded by Dori Berinstein, and committed to producing premiere Broadway, Film, TV and cutting edge new technology productions. Dori is a three-time Tony-winning Broadway Producer and a Film Director and Producer. Recent productions include: (For Broadway) Legally Blonde", "Thoroughly Modern Millie", "Once Flew Over The Cuckoo's Next", "The Crucible" and "Fool Moon"; (For Film as Director & Producer) "Gotta Dance", "Some Assembly Required" and "ShowBusiness: The Road To Broadway". Dori is the 2009 recipient of the Robert Whitehead Award for 'outstanding achievement in commercial theatre producing'.

Broadway Cares / Equity Fights AIDS is one of the nation's leading industry-based, nonprofit AIDS fundraising and grant-making organizations. By drawing upon the talents, resources and generosity of the American theatre community, since 1988 BC/EFA has raised over $195 million for essential services for people with AIDS and other critical illnesses across the United States. BC/EFA is the major supporter of seven programs at The Actors Fund, including The HIV/AIDS Initiative, The Phyllis Newman Women's Health Initiative, The Al Hirschfeld Free Health Clinic and more. BC/EFA also awards annual grants to more than 400 AIDS and family service organizations nationwide.
